Plinz argued that minds, like Minecraft, are not physical and cannot exist in the physical universe, and that physics says nothing meaningful about consciousness.

NathanpmYoung calls this a 'deepness arbitrage' — using ambiguous terms to imply transcendence — and rebuts it plainly: Minecraft does exist in the physical universe as a program on his computer, so why couldn't his mind likewise be a program running on his brain?
